Purpose:

The medical device Service Technician evaluates, troubleshoots to component level, completes, and documents repairs of analog and digital camera controllers, camera heads, light sources, optical couplers, and other products as directed. Completes required repairs by aligning or upgrading software, burning-in, and testing (Final Check Out) of Returned Goods. Repairs and documentation must be in compliance with regulatory requirements. Primary objective is to complete repairs in a timely manner to reduce turnaround time and improve customer satisfaction.

Duties

and Responsibilities
  • Analyze Returned Good customer feedback/complaint and compare symptom to alleged product failure
  • Perform troubleshooting to component level as necessary to determine failure
  • Provide failure analysis information to Engineering to support root cause investigation as necessary
  • Provide estimates of repair cost for customer quote as necessary
  • Route repairs to Production as appropriate
  • Complete repair/upgrade as necessary/appropriate
  • Complete burn-in, Final Checkout, and safety testing as required
  • Update repair/complaint and device history records as required
  • Maintain product change history file for reference of applicable engineering changes effecting repaired products. Perform Oracle Transactions (Verify Service Request, Comment on Serviceable items, review quoted cost to determine if higher authorization is needed and if work can be performed within the quoted cost.
Required Qualifications
  • Two years’ experience in electronic/mechanical assembly and soldering experience within the past 12 months.
  • Ability to pass soldering skills assessment
  • Must be able to perform work at a workbench height of 37.5"-42", sit and stand as necessary, move about, bend, stoop, use hands and lift up to 40 lbs periodically as needed.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Electronic Technician or Repair Technician experience preferred.
  • AA/AS Degree in Electronic Technology or equivalent experience preferred.

CONMED Corporation is a progressive, global medical device company. Through thoughtful leadership, innovation and team work, we are changing the future of medicine. Our 3,500 employees worldwide make meaningful contributions, positively impact the business, and advance in their careers as our company and product portfolio grows. We are a leader in Orthopedics, General Surgery, Gynecology, Gastroenterology, Pulmonology, and Anesthesiology and our employees enjoy challenging and diverse job opportunities across these varied specializations.

We are headquartered in upstate New York with additional domestic facilities in FL, CA, MA, CO, and GA. We have an international presence in more than 20 locations throughout Europe, Australia, Latin America, Asia, North America, and the Middle East.
